Point-of-Care Ultrasound in Medical Education – Stop Listening and Look

A generation of physicians will need to be trained to view this technology as an extension of their senses, just as many generations have viewed the stethoscope. That development will require the medical education community to embrace and incorporate the technology throughout the curriculum.

Feasibility and Accuracy of Point-of-Care Pocket-Size Ultrasonography Performed by Medical Students

Medical students with minimal training were able to use a Pocket-Size Imaging Device (PSID) as a supplement to standard physical examination and successfully acquire acceptable relevant organ recordings for presentation and correctly interpret these with great accuracy.

Seeing is Believing – Evaluating a Point-of-Care Ultrasound Curriculum for 1st-Year Medical Students

Students and faculty valued the curriculum, and students demonstrated basic competency in performance and interpretation of ultrasound.
Further study is needed to determine how to best incorporate this emerging technology into a robust learning experience for medical students.

Development and Evaluation of Methodologies for Teaching Focused Cardiac Ultrasound Skills to Medical Students

Third-year medical students were able to acquire Focused Cardiac Ultrasound (FCU) image acquisition and interpretation skills after a novel training program. Self-directed electronic modules are effective for teaching introductory FCU interpretation skills, while expert-guided training is important for developing scanning technique
